From: JongHeon Choi Date: Thu, 27 Apr 2017 04:32:28 +0000 (+0900) Subject: Remove the cap_mac_admin for dotnet-launcher X-Git-Tag: accepted/tizen/unified/20170428.032535^0 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=9e24b5e89b5022a29abc318b67f31493acd21fcc;p=platform%2Fcore%2Fdotnet%2Flauncher.git Remove the cap_mac_admin for dotnet-launcher Change-Id: I96ac4601185314edeee80e39bb67a512f1816610 --- diff --git a/NativeLauncher/CMakeLists.txt b/NativeLauncher/CMakeLists.txt index 4107d05..e453d9a 100755 --- a/NativeLauncher/CMakeLists.txt +++ b/NativeLauncher/CMakeLists.txt @@ -113,15 +113,15 @@ ADD_EXECUTABLE(${NITOOL} ${${NITOOL}_SOURCE_FILES}) SET_TARGET_PROPERTIES(${NITOOL} PROPERTIES COMPILE_FLAGS "-fPIE") TARGET_LINK_LIBRARIES(${NITOOL} ${${PROJECT_NAME}_LDFLAGS} "-pie") -SET(INSTALLER_PLUGIN "ui-application") -SET(${INSTALLER_PLUGIN}_SOURCE_FILES - util/utils.cc - installer-plugin/common.cc - installer-plugin/ui-application.cc -) -ADD_LIBRARY(${INSTALLER_PLUGIN} SHARED ${${INSTALLER_PLUGIN}_SOURCE_FILES}) -SET_TARGET_PROPERTIES(${INSTALLER_PLUGIN} PROPERTIES COMPILE_FLAGS "-fPIC") -TARGET_LINK_LIBRARIES(${INSTALLER_PLUGIN} ${${PROJECT_NAME}_LDFLAGS}) +#SET(INSTALLER_PLUGIN "ui-application") +#SET(${INSTALLER_PLUGIN}_SOURCE_FILES +# util/utils.cc +# installer-plugin/common.cc +# installer-plugin/ui-application.cc +#) +#ADD_LIBRARY(${INSTALLER_PLUGIN} SHARED ${${INSTALLER_PLUGIN}_SOURCE_FILES}) +#SET_TARGET_PROPERTIES(${INSTALLER_PLUGIN} PROPERTIES COMPILE_FLAGS "-fPIC") +#TARGET_LINK_LIBRARIES(${INSTALLER_PLUGIN} ${${PROJECT_NAME}_LDFLAGS}) SET(PREFER_DOTNET_AOT_PLUGIN "prefer_dotnet_aot_plugin") @@ -139,7 +139,7 @@ IF(NOT DEFINED NO_TIZEN) INSTALL(TARGETS ${DOTNET_LAUNCHER} DESTINATION ${BINDIR}) INSTALL(TARGETS ${SCD_LAUNCHER} DESTINATION ${BINDIR}) INSTALL(TARGETS ${NITOOL} DESTINATION ${BINDIR}) - INSTALL(TARGETS ${INSTALLER_PLUGIN} DESTINATION ${INSTALL_PLUGIN_DIR}) +# INSTALL(TARGETS ${INSTALLER_PLUGIN} DESTINATION ${INSTALL_PLUGIN_DIR}) INSTALL(TARGETS ${PREFER_DOTNET_AOT_PLUGIN} DESTINATION ${INSTALL_MDPLUGIN_DIR}) INSTALL(FILES dotnet.loader DESTINATION ${LOADERDIR}) INSTALL(FILES dotnet.launcher DESTINATION ${LOADERDIR}) diff --git a/packaging/dotnet-launcher.spec b/packaging/dotnet-launcher.spec index f82e994..847558a 100755 --- a/packaging/dotnet-launcher.spec +++ b/packaging/dotnet-launcher.spec @@ -26,7 +26,6 @@ BuildRequires: pkgconfig(appcore-agent) BuildRequires: pkgconfig(capi-appfw-app-control) BuildRequires: pkgconfig(capi-appfw-application) BuildRequires: pkgconfig(capi-appfw-service-application) -BuildRequires: pkgconfig(capi-appfw-service-application) Requires: aul @@ -106,13 +105,13 @@ ln -sf %{_libdir}/libsqlite3.so.0 %{buildroot}%{_native_lib_dir}/libsqlite3.so %{_loaderdir}/dotnet.launcher %{_loaderdir}/dotnet.debugger %{_native_lib_dir}/libsqlite3.so -%caps(cap_mac_admin,cap_setgid=ei) %{_bindir}/dotnet-launcher -%caps(cap_mac_admin,cap_setgid=ei) %{_bindir}/nitool -%caps(cap_mac_admin,cap_setgid=ei) %{_install_plugin_dir}/libui-application.so -%caps(cap_mac_admin,cap_setgid=ei) %{_install_mdplugin_dir}/libprefer_dotnet_aot_plugin.so +%{_bindir}/nitool +#%{_install_plugin_dir}/libui-application.so +%{_install_mdplugin_dir}/libprefer_dotnet_aot_plugin.so %if %{use_managed_launcher} -%caps(cap_mac_admin,cap_setgid=ei) %{_bindir}/Tizen.Runtime.dll +%{_bindir}/Tizen.Runtime.dll %endif +%caps(cap_setgid=ei) %{_bindir}/dotnet-launcher %files -n scd-launcher -%caps(cap_mac_admin,cap_setgid=ei) %{_bindir}/scd-launcher +%caps(cap_setgid=ei) %{_bindir}/scd-launcher